Elsie Ao Ieong (Chinese: 歐陽瑜) is a Macau civil servant, serving as the Secretary for Social Affairs and Culture and Secretary of the Talents Development Committee in the Macau Government, and is currently their highest-ranking female civil servant. She previously headed the Macau Female Civil Servant Association.

Early life and education

Elsie Ao Ieong has lived in Macau since the 1990s.[1] She completed an undergraduate and master's degree in engineering and computer engineering respectively, and later earned a second post-graduate degree in comparative law.[1]

Career

Elsie Ao Ieong was a civil servant and headed Macau's Identification Services Bureau.[2] She was later selected to be the Secretary for Social Affairs and Culture, replacing Alexis Tam.[2] She is the only woman to be a part of the cabinet appointed by Ho Iat-Seng, the current Chief Executive of Macau. She is also the only woman member of Macau's Executive Council, making her the highest-ranking female civil servant in Macau.[1] In 2022, she was given additional charge of Macau's Talents Development Committee, a government agency charged with developing human resources in Macau.[3]

Elsie Ao Ieong previously headed the Macau Female Civil Servant Association.[1]

As Secretary for Social Affairs and Culture, she has managed travel restrictions and quarantine regulations with respect to Macau's response to the global COVID-19 pandemic.[4][5]
